How much did it cost to have a baby in 1968?

In 1968, the average cost of having a baby in the United States was approximately $1,500 to $2,000. This amount typically included hospital fees, physician charges, and other associated costs. Adjusting for inflation, this would be equivalent to around $10,000 to $15,000 today, depending on the specific circumstances and location. Costs varied widely based on factors such as the type of delivery and hospital.
